平板湍流边界层整体摩擦阻力的振荡性

The Fluctuation of the Total Skin Friction of a Flat Plate in Turbulent Boundary Layer

【摘要】 本文分别用流场显示和阻力测量两种实验方法,证明了平板整体摩擦阻力存在着振荡性,并得到了其振荡的一些规律和特点。另外,提出了一个与时间相关联的内层速度分布模型。并对其合理性进行了研究,从而导出一个与时间相关联的整体摩擦阻力模型。

【Abstract】 In this paper,it was proved by flow visualization and drag measurement that the total skin friction of the flat-plate is fluctuating,and some rules and features of the fluctuation were ob- tained.Theoretical analysis was conducted for the fluctuation by advancing a new law which is con- netted with time about the distribution of the inner layer velocity in turbulent boundary layer.In addi- tion,the reasonableness of the law was analysed and a formula of total skin friction associated with time was obtained.
